Social Media Presence: Tracking Twitter and Telegram follower growth as primary indicators of community reach in 2026

Social media platforms have become essential barometers for assessing cryptocurrency community strength and reach. Twitter and Telegram follower growth serve as tangible metrics that reflect genuine community interest and project visibility in the evolving crypto landscape of 2026. These platforms enable teams to build direct communication channels with supporters, making follower counts meaningful indicators of ecosystem adoption rates.

Tracking Twitter followers provides insight into a project's discoverability and influence within the broader crypto ecosystem. Growth patterns on this platform often correlate with market sentiment shifts, news announcements, and community engagement levels. A consistent upward trajectory in followers typically signals increasing credibility and expanding reach among crypto enthusiasts, traders, and potential investors monitoring developments in the sector.

Telegram communities complement this picture by revealing deeper engagement patterns. Unlike Twitter's public-facing nature, Telegram groups demonstrate actual community participation through member activity, message frequency, and discussion quality. Follower growth in Telegram chat channels indicates not just awareness but genuine commitment from community members who actively participate in conversations and ecosystem development.

When measuring these metrics in 2026, focus on growth velocity rather than absolute numbers alone. A project showing 50% monthly follower growth demonstrates stronger community momentum than one with larger but stagnating follower bases. Cross-referencing Twitter and Telegram growth rates reveals whether community expansion is broad-based or concentrated in specific demographics, informing assessments of overall ecosystem health and sustainability in the competitive crypto market.

Community Engagement Metrics: Analyzing interaction frequency and sentiment to measure active participation levels

Measuring crypto community engagement requires analyzing both quantitative and qualitative dimensions of how members interact within the ecosystem. Community engagement metrics serve as fundamental indicators of project health, capturing everything from transaction activity to social discourse patterns. Interaction frequency represents the quantifiable side—tracking how often community members participate in discussions, share content, and execute transactions across platforms like exchanges and social channels. Sentiment analysis complements frequency metrics by examining the tone and nature of community interactions. Rather than simply counting posts or transactions, sentiment measurement evaluates whether participants express positive, neutral, or negative perspectives about the project. This distinction matters significantly because high interaction frequency paired with negative sentiment may signal community discord or dissatisfaction, whereas positive sentiment during growth phases typically indicates stronger long-term participation potential. Advanced measurement approaches analyze social media mentions, forum discussions, and on-chain communication patterns to build comprehensive engagement profiles. By combining interaction frequency data with sentiment scoring, ecosystem analysts can distinguish between genuinely active, healthy communities and those experiencing superficial activity without substantive support. These composite engagement metrics ultimately provide clearer visibility into which projects cultivate genuine participation versus artificial activity metrics.

Developer Ecosystem Strength: Evaluating GitHub contributions and developer activity as signals of project viability

Developer activity on platforms like GitHub provides concrete, measurable evidence of a project's technical momentum and long-term viability. When evaluating a cryptocurrency project's developer ecosystem strength, examining GitHub contributions reveals how actively engineers are building, maintaining, and improving the codebase. High-frequency commits, consistent pull requests, and responsive issue resolution indicate a project that prioritizes development quality and user experience.

The composition of the developer community matters equally. Projects with diverse contributor bases—beyond core team members—demonstrate broader ecosystem adoption and reduce dependency risks. Tracking metrics such as the number of active developers, commit frequency over time, and the ratio of external contributors to core maintainers provides insight into whether a project attracts independent talent or relies solely on internal resources.

Response times to pull requests and issue management also signal developer ecosystem health. Teams that promptly review contributions and address bugs demonstrate professional standards and respect for community involvement. Additionally, the presence of comprehensive documentation and developer-focused tools suggests a project that invests in enabling third-party development.

These developer activity signals transcend hype cycles and price volatility, offering more reliable indicators of a cryptocurrency project's fundamental strength than marketing metrics alone. Strong developer ecosystems typically correlate with sustained innovation and resilience during market downturns, making GitHub analysis an essential component of evaluating which projects possess genuine technological merit and growth potential.

DApp Adoption Scale: Assessing the number of active decentralized applications and their transaction volumes as ecosystem maturity indicators

The number of active decentralized applications serves as a direct barometer for ecosystem maturity and technological adoption within blockchain networks. Measuring DApp adoption scale requires examining both quantitative metrics—such as the count of active projects and their daily transaction volumes—and qualitative indicators of user engagement and ecosystem health.

Transaction volumes generated by these decentralized applications provide crucial insights into actual ecosystem utilization rather than speculative activity. A mature ecosystem typically demonstrates diversified DApp activity across multiple categories: DeFi protocols, gaming applications, NFT marketplaces, and social platforms. When analyzing ecosystem activity in 2026, practitioners should track which DApp categories generate the highest transaction throughput and user retention rates.

Platforms like Solana exemplify how ecosystem maturity correlates with increased DApp proliferation and transaction velocity. The relationship between active decentralized applications and ecosystem metrics reveals that sustained growth depends on continual developer adoption and user migration toward productive applications. Rather than focusing solely on DApp count, sophisticated analysis weighs transaction volumes per application, monthly active users, and lock value within protocols.

Evaluating ecosystem maturity through DApp adoption scale provides stakeholders with actionable intelligence about technological progression and market confidence. This metric captures whether blockchain networks attract serious builders and users or merely accumulate dormant projects, making it essential for comprehensive community activity assessment.

How do you differentiate between genuine community activity and artificial engagement/bots in crypto projects?

Analyze on-chain transaction patterns, wallet age distribution, and holder concentration. Genuine communities show organic growth, diverse participation, consistent transaction volume, and authentic social discussions. Bots typically exhibit repetitive behavior, coordinated timing, and concentrated wallet addresses with minimal on-chain interaction.
